Research Abstract |
The tumor oxygen consumption rate in tumor-bearing mice using ^<17>O MRS/MRI was investigated based on the metabolically generated ^<17>O-water from ^<17>O2 gas. ^<17>O images were acquired before and after the inhalation of ^<17>O enriched oxygen gas. The increment in the ^<17>O image intensity due to the metabolically generated H2^<17>O from ^<17>O2 was converted to the quantity of produced H2^<17>O, which was in good agreement with physiological data in literature. We confirmed this method promising as a tool for monitoring the oxygen consumption rate in tumor.
